 LC    Russet Sparrow* Id (Atlas):
    Passer cinnamomeus

Description (10)
Image of Russet Sparrow
 

Other Names (World)
Russet Sparrow, Cinnamon Sparrow, Cinnamon Tree Sparrow, Ruddy Sparrow

Family
Passeridae (Old World Sparrows)

Size
13.50 - 14 cm

First Described (Guide)
(Temminck, 1835)

Habitat
Subtropical and tropical montane moist forest, high altitude shrubland, arable land.

Range (Guide)
Bhutan (B), China (mainland), India, Japan, Laos, Myanmar, Nepal, North Korea (B), Pakistan, Russia (Asian), South Korea (B), Taiwan (China), Thailand, Vietnam.

Vagrant to Afghanistan.

Population
Estimated population is unknown (2010).

Subspecies
Has been considered to form a superspecies with Somali Sparrow (Passer castanopterus), and sometimes treated as conspecific.

Proposed subspecies batangensis (described from western Batang area of Sichuan, in China) considered synonymous with intensior.

The following 3 subspecies are recognised:

  • cinnamomeus (Temminck, 1835)   -  North-eastern Afghanistan eastern in Himalayas (mostly above 1800 m) to southern China (southern and south-eastern Xizang and southern Qinghai) and north-eastern India (Arunchal Pradesh).
  • intensior Rothschild, 1922   -  North-eastern India (Assam), south-central and southern China, and northern Myanmar east to northern Laos and north-western Vietnam.
  • rutilans (Temminck, 1836)   -  North-central and eastern China, Korea, Taiwan, southern Sakhalin I, southern Kuril Is and Japan.
